PFAS are actually synthetic elements utilized in numerous items, like firefighting froths, food packaging, as well as waterproof materials for apparel and also household furniture. Analysts have linked visibility to the elements along with decreased fetal development, increased cholesterol amounts, as well as improved risk of thyroid illness, and many more wellness effects.Placenta is understudiedUnderstanding exactly how early-life visibility to environmental pollutants can establish show business for future wellness issues is actually a major enthusiasm in the laboratory of Sue Fenton, Ph.D., head of the Reproductive Endocrinology Team at NIEHS. Her mentee Bevin Blake, Ph.D., reviewed job she accomplished in Fenton's lab as a graduate student. Blake mentioned her analysis including 2 PFAS called perfluorooctanoic acid (PFOA) and GenX. (Image thanks to Steve McCaw)" We know that PFOA has been examined as a procreative toxicant in mice, and also we know that GenX is a preferred substitute for PFOA," she pointed out. "Does GenX visibility similarly impact duplication or growth in mice?" Blake's research in a rodent design taken a look at developing outcomes after visibility to PFOA or GenX. She found that exposure to either material raised placental weight." Bigger typically means an unfavorable response in the animals," said Blake. "That looking for usually tends to advise there is actually one thing exciting going on, but our team needed to zoom in to enjoy what that may be." So, the team, which also consisted of Susan Elmore, D.V.M., a veterinary medical officer and also workers researcher at NIEHS, examined the microanatomy of the placenta's internal compartment, where nutrients pass from mommy to cultivating youngster. This place is actually referred to as the placental labyrinth.High exposure to PFOA caused firmly stuffed placental labyrinth cells, which proposed the tissues may certainly not be actually capable perform their ordinary functions. At both higher and lesser amounts of GenX visibility, the labyrinth cells had atrophied, or even wasted away, which may indicate that even low focus of the material may hurt advancement in mice. A lot work remains to a lot better comprehend the much more than 8,000 various PFAS that exist, as some have actually been actually extra widely used and also analyzed than others.The range of PFASAccording to the EPA, there are much more than 8,000 different PFAS. Some have actually been even more largely analyzed than others." environmental protection agency's program is to use computational toxicology to resolve these relevant information voids that exist for the substantial bulk of PFAS," pointed out Poise Patlewicz, Ph.D., a researcher at the environmental protection agency National Facility for Computational Toxicology and Exposure.Patlewicz as well as co-workers put together a library of 430 PFAS to grab the range of the chemical training class. Next, they picked a depictive set of 150 drugs for non-animal screening. The objective is to evaluate for potential results on human brain development as well as the immune system, for example, and also assist improve specific PFAS for greater amount testing." Results until now display broad variant in organic task for different PFAS," mentioned Patlewicz.She took note that the 150 representative elements were separated into various building distinctions based upon chemical features.
